Transaction 59cd450f7806410b27e9390b8f8c8736668b811f500319ba8573c05a6187d54a
1 Input
1 Output
-
59cd450f7806410b27e9390b8f8c8736668b811f500319ba8573c05a6187d54a:0
- value
- 685156
- script pubkey
- OP_0 OP_PUSHBYTES_20 20123270280cf2d266fc49ebf0579af4f586874a
- address
- bc1qyqfryupgpnedyehuf84lq4u67n6cdp623ayx8v